    Do you need a hard to find material for a crafty project? This store is the place to go. After searching for extra wide cellophane for several weeks I happened into Michael's on So. Hurstborne while in the area. I approached one of the checkers as I entered the store and rather than point me in the general direction she nicely closed her non busy cash register and walked me to section of the store with cake decorating items and cellophane. The alternate checker only had an existing customer so this did not inconvenience any other customers. I found exactly what I had been searching for. Cake boards and shining clear cellophane in a variety of sizes. I explained my project to the clerk and she helped me decide on which board to purchase. (I was making a wedding cake out of folded towels and misc kitchen items.) When I brought it to the cash register to purchase I mentioned my spur of the moment visit to the store and that I should have brought the 40% off coupon from the Sunday paper. "No problem we can offer you a better discount on this purchase if you sign up for our email ads." I did and received 50% off the most expensive item being purchased. Wow, I'm a fan of the vast variety of craft materials and the pleasant personalities of the employees. I'll be back!

    I love this place! We've been here two times during spring break with my kiddo!…read more I love the selection of items they have to paint. They give great instructions on how to achieve the look and color you are hoping for. Anyone can paint!! The prices are listed on all the ceramics and there are small to large pieces. You will have to leave your art for about a week before it's baked and ready. They also offer glass making and clay pottery classes. They offer spring and summer break camps too!! You can walk in any time to paint, which I love! This is a great rainy day activity! There is not a studio fee that most played charge. Great service and experience! Plan to be here an 1-2 hours.

    First time reviewing after going here for big occasions for years! I most recently visited for…read moretheir Valentine's Day Craft session and I had such a good time! I made some concrete coasters from scratch while I sipped an espresso martini. The service is prompt, and the specialists are also really kind and knowledgeable. The crafts range from simple to complex, and every craft is very independent! Avoid if you're not into loud noises as the work space is a little small and others and their crafts will be making lots of noise! (Especially the hammer for the leather works!) I've never had a drink here I didn't love, but the espresso martini especially is one of my favorites in the city. Really mellow flavor and very foamy. The Craftery is perfect for bachelorette parties, birthdays, and date nights. Next time skip the fancy dinner and make some concrete coasters instead! Then grab some takeout and enjoy your craft!
